School Superintendent directs and manages a school district. Oversees all aspects of the district's operational policies, objectives, initiatives. Being a School Superintendent is responsible for the attainment of short- and long-term financial and operational goals for the school system. Requ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, School Superintendent typically reports to top management. May require a master's degree. The School Superintendent manages a departmental sub-function within a broader departmental function. Creates functional strategies and specific objectives for the sub-function and develops budgets/policies/procedures to support the functional infrastructure. Deep knowledge of the managed sub-function and solid knowledge of the overall departmental function. To be a School Superintendent typically requires 5+ years of managerial experience. The West Seneca Central School District Board of Education announces a confidential search for its Superintendent of Schools. The Board is seeking an educational leader committed to open-minded, collaborative leadership and a proven record of soliciting input from stakeholders. Approximately 5,903 attend five elementary buildings, two middle schools and two high schools. The District provides a strong comprehensive academic program with a commitment to interscholastic athletics and instruction in the visual and performing arts.
The District’s four-year graduation rate consistently exceeds 90% with close to 45% of graduates regularly receiving a Regents Diploma with Advanced Designation. Both District high schools offer eight advanced placement and twenty-one dual enrollment courses as well as nationally recognized Academy programs including Academies of Business and Finance, IT/Digital Media, Visual Arts, Life Science, and Engineering.
The District provides a robust special education program including a full local continuum of services for children and is committed to fostering the well-being and supporting the mental health needs of both students and staff. The District serves as a community hub and offers a rich and responsive community education program to meet the needs of a diverse population.
